  • Bronntanas at SDCC Libraries

    Bronntanas is a celebration of the possibilities that the Irish language creates for families. You don't need to have perfect Irish to give this gift to your child. Ordinary life can be transformed into magical things - bedtime stories, conversations in the kitchen, trips to sports games.

  • Cruinniú na nÓg 2025 at South Dublin Libraries

    Cruinniú na nÓg is Ireland’s national day of free creativity for children and young people under 18 — and the only celebration of its kind in the world. As part of the Creative Ireland Programme’s Creative Youth Plan, it offers young people across the country a chance to express themselves through hands-on creative activities — all completely free! This year at South Dublin Libraries, we’re turning up the volume with our theme: “Loud at the Library” — a joyful celebration of all things music. From the rhythm of traditional Irish tunes to the elegance of classical music, from spontaneous library busking to instrument-making workshops and beat-driven sessions, we’re filling our branches with sound, creativity, and community spirit. Whether you’re a young musician, a curious listener, or just want to make a little joyful noise, there’s something for everyone in this year’s Cruinniú na nÓg line-up.
